Various Types of Websites You Can Create
The website you decide to create depends on your objectives, target audience, and the features you need. Whether you opt for an eCommerce platform, a brochure website, or a customised solution, each type fulfils a distinct purpose and meets specific requirements. Here is a summary of the various types of websites you can develop:
1. eCommerce Websites
Purpose:
E-commerce websites in the UK are created to sell products or services on the internet. They offer a platform for businesses to display their products and services, handle transactions, and oversee inventory.
Key Features:
- Catalogues of products with detailed descriptions, pictures, and prices.
- Secure payment gateways are available for online transactions.
- Shopping trolley function for purchasing multiple items.
- User accounts allow for personalised experiences and order tracking.

Examples:
- Online retail stores such as Amazon or Etsy.
- Subscription services such as HelloFresh are very popular.
- Specialised product websites for handcrafted goods, clothing or technology accessories.
E-commerce platforms such as Shopify, WooCommerce, or Magento can be utilised to develop these websites, or alternatively, a bespoke e-commerce site can be constructed for a more personalised experience.
2. Brochure Websites
Purpose:
Brochure websites are ideal for businesses or organisations that are seeking to establish an online presence without the requirement for complex functionality. They serve as a digital “brochure,” presenting information about a business, its services, and contact details.
Key Features:
- Straightforward navigation featuring a sleek, expertly designed layout.
- About Us, Services, FAQ’s and Contact pages.
- Fundamental SEO techniques to enhance visibility in search engines.
- Incorporation of contact forms and social media links.
Examples:
- Local tradespeople such as plumbers, electricians, or hairdressers.
- Small businesses like cafes, boutiques, or consultants.
- Charities displaying their objectives and activities.
Brochure websites are frequently constructed using platforms such as WordPress or Wix, which makes them cost-effective and simple to upkeep.
3. Bespoke Websites
Purpose:
Custom-made websites are created from the ground up to fulfil individual requirements. They are perfect for companies or organisations that require specific features or branding that cannot be provided by templates or pre-made solutions.
Key Features:
- Bespoke design and user experience in harmony with the brand’s identity.
- Bespoke features, such as distinct booking systems, APIs, or user dashboards.
- Scalability for future expansion and integration with other systems.
- Improved performance and optimised code for speed and reliability.
Examples:
- Tailor-made platforms such as Airbnb or Uber, created for bespoke user experiences.
- Corporate websites with distinctive branding and features.
- Start-ups need innovative features to distinguish themselves in their market.
These websites necessitate cooperation with developers and designers in order to accomplish a completely customised solution, frequently constructed using frameworks such as React, Laravel, or Django.
By understanding these types of websites, you can choose the one that best aligns with your goals, ensuring an effective and engaging online presence.
How Much Does Website Design Cost?
The costs of website design can vary significantly based on the complexity of the project and the expertise of the designer. For instance, a simple brochure website may cost in the range of £500 to £2,000, while an e-commerce site could be priced between £1,000 and £5,000. Custom-built websites, known for their distinctive features, usually begin at £10,000 and can exceed this amount.

Chalfont St Peter, a charming village nestled in the heart of Buckinghamshire, has captivated the hearts of many for its quintessential English beauty, rich history, and vibrant community spirit. Whether you are a resident or a visitor, there are countless reasons why this picturesque village is beloved by all who have had the pleasure of experiencing its unique charm.
First and foremost, one cannot help but be enamoured by the stunning natural surroundings that Chalfont St Peter has to offer. From its lush green fields to its tranquil waterways, the village is a haven for nature lovers seeking peace and serenity away from the hustle and bustle of urban life. The meandering River Misbourne adds to the village’s idyllic setting, providing a perfect backdrop for leisurely walks and picnics along its banks.
Chalfont St Peter is also steeped in history, with a heritage that dates back centuries. The village boasts a wealth of historic buildings, including the beautiful parish church of St Peter and St Paul, which dates back to the 12th century. Walking through the village’s quaint streets, one can’t help but feel transported back in time, as the architecture and atmosphere evoke a sense of nostalgia for a bygone era.
